## Template Rendering Performance — Approval Process

For the weekly eng sync: any change touching the Quillshade rendering pipeline now requires a performance approval before merge. Benchmarks must show p95 render latency under 80ms on the standard corpus, and cache hit rates must not regress by more than 2%. Results get posted to the perf channel with the benchmark run attached. Final sign-off on all rendering performance changes belongs to the approver named below.

account owner for bawip-tahag: Raleth Quenok

# Break-Glass: Catalog Cache Invalidation

Scope: the Pinrow product catalog at Veldstone Retail. If stale prices persist after a purge and the Hollowmere invalidation queue is wedged, use break-glass to flush the edge tier directly. Contractors: get verbal sign-off from the catalog lead first. Steps: open the Hollowmere admin shell, select emergency-flush, confirm the tenant, and run it once — repeated flushes thrash the origin. Access is logged and expires after 20 minutes. Unseal the admin shell with the passphrase below.

recovery phrase for kahop-tajog: istix-casvan

When the Proctorline exam queue backs up, drain workers one at a time and verify each candidate session is re-enqueued, never dropped. Check the dead-letter count before and after. Workers won't authenticate to the queue broker without the shared signing credential, so add it to your env file on the next line.

vault entry, yahif-yajep: COURIER_KEY29=b802bdf8034096b65a51c6ba5abe2

Handover — queue migration (Torvald → Mirela)

We're retiring the homegrown Sledrunner queue in favor of Pylonback. Plugin authors must swap enqueue() calls for the new dispatch API; old workers drain Friday. Retry semantics changed: at-least-once now, dedupe yourself. Docs live on the Harkvale wiki. The staging broker unlocks with the recovery passphrase below.

strongbox words: gilok-druion-briath-wendor-briion-prawyn-fenion-oliir-casdor-holius-briius-gilath-gilael-pelys